The Devotion of Suspect X by Keigo Higashino is the latest book I was offered to review and I'm glad that I got to read this novel.
Review:
First, the facts - This novel was originally written in Japanese and translated into English by Alexander O Smith and Elye J Alexander; in my opinion it's quite a good translation with very minute detailing.
The novel is a thriller with an unusual plot, the murder happens in the first chapter and the reader knows fully well how the murder was committed, the circumstances behind it, leading to it and also the murderer. The interest of the reader is aroused by this to a great deal, I mean everything is clear...so what next?????
Well, the story then takes very interesting twists and turns, when the police investigation of the murder starts.....and every event, right from location of the victim's body to the clues are totally different from what the reader knows in the first chapter; it becomes an exciting read, like a jigsaw puzzle for the reader to fill in the gaps between what he/she has already read in the first chapter and the subsequent chapter. Each character has been fleshed out very well with backgrounds and well rounded characterizations, even the minor characters. The characters, the circumstances and the plot are very very believable, the murder is committed by one of the main characters as a spur of the moment act, which is very believable, given her background and circumstances. In fact, the reader may even be sympathetic to her. The interactions between the various characters have been etched out very well and it reads like interesting everyday conversations. Also, every character is not black or white, all of them area bit of grey..all have thier everyday problems, worries and setbacks ..and each one has a past which has a shade of the usual unhappiness. It is on the basis of this very past, each individual character acts the way he/she does. In fact, the brilliance of the whole plot after the murder lies in the action of another main character, who has behaved in the most natural way for him based on his emotions and feelings for the actual murderer. As the investigations move forward, the plot becomes more and more complex and the police find themselves against the wall, all their clues lead to nowhere. Then, one of the main characters decide to confess to the crime and it becomes even more complex, the police cannot are suspicious of the story and so is the reader. However, the confession is also very believable and not only that, it seems very very logical and one is almost sure it is the actual thing that did happen. The story then throws an interesting googly and it is the most bizarre one, which is the final piece of this thrilling murder jigsaw puzzle plot!! The ending is very exciting and also a bit painful, one does feel a bit for the devotion of suspect X, that he perhaps could have had a bit love requited back.
The ending left me completely well satisfied having read a good thriller in a long time and I would recommend it to everyone who's interested in thrillers to grab a copy of this novel.
